Life can sometimes feel overwhelming, whether you're struggling with anxiety, depression, OCD, stress, relationship challenges, emotional ups and downs, or difficult life transitions. Individual therapy offers a supportive space for you to better understand yourself, navigate challenges, and build a life that feels more aligned with your values and goals.
My approach is grounded in evidence-based treatments, including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T), and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P) for OCD and anxiety-related concerns. Together, we'll work to better understand the thoughts, emotions, and behaviors that may be contributing to your difficulties, while building practical skills to manage emotions, strengthen relationships, and create meaningful change.

Relationships can be one of the greatest sources of connection and fulfillment, but they can also bring challenges. Couples often seek therapy when they find themselves stuck in recurring conflicts, struggling with communication, feeling disconnected, rebuilding trust, or navigating major life transitions.
My approach integrates principles from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) and the Gottman Method to help couples better understand one another, improve communication, manage conflict more effectively, and strengthen emotional connection. Together, we will work to identify unhelpful interaction patterns, develop healthier ways of responding to one another, and create a stronger foundation for your relationship.
Whether you are facing a specific challenge or simply want to strengthen your partnership, couples therapy can provide tools to help you build a more connected and resilient relationship.

Parenting can be deeply rewarding, but it can also be challenging and overwhelming. Whether you're navigating behavioral concerns, emotional outbursts, anxiety, school-related difficulties, family conflict, or the everyday demands of raising children and teens, support can help you feel more confident and effective in your role as a parent.
Drawing from evidence-based approaches, I work collaboratively with parents to better understand their children's needs, strengthen communication, foster emotional resilience, set effective limits, and build stronger parent-child relationships.
I also specialize in supporting parents of emerging adults as they navigate the transition to greater independence. Together, we can address challenges related to autonomy, mental health, executive functioning, and changing family dynamics while maintaining connection and strengthening your relationship.
Whether you're facing a specific concern or simply looking for guidance and support, my goal is to help you feel more empowered in your role as a parent.

Executive functioning skills are the mental processes that help us plan, organize, manage time, stay focused, initiate tasks, and follow through on responsibilities. Difficulties in these areas can affect academic performance, work productivity, daily routines, and overall well-being.
Executive functioning coaching is designed to help children, adolescents, and young adults develop practical systems and strategies to manage the demands of school, work, and everyday life. Together, we will identify areas of difficulty, build personalized organizational tools, improve time management, strengthen problem-solving skills, and develop sustainable habits that support success.
My approach emphasizes collaboration, accountability, and skill-building, helping clients gain confidence and independence while learning strategies that can be applied across settings.
